4. PUBLIC COMMENTS
'Public Comments' is defined as time set aside for citizens to express their views for items not on the agenda. During a period designated for public comment, the mayor or chair may allot each speaker a maximum amount of time to present their comments, subject to extension by the mayor or by a majority vote of the council. Speakers offering duplicate comments may be limited. Because of the need for proper public notice, immediate action cannot be taken in the Council Meeting. The Chair of the meeting reserves the right to organize public comments by topic and may group speakers accordingly. If action is necessary, the item will be listed on a future agenda; however, the Council may elect to discuss the item if it is an immediate matter of concern. 10. CLOSED SESSION
The Mayor and City Council pursuant to Utah Code 52-4-205 may vote to go into a closed session for the purpose of (these are just a few of the items listed, see Utah Code 52-4-205 for the entire list):
a discussion of the character, professional competence, or physical or mental health of an individual
b strategy sessions to discuss collective bargaining
c strategy sessions to discuss pending or reasonably imminent litigation
d strategy sessions to discuss the purchase, exchange, or lease of real property, including any form of a water right or water shares
e strategy sessions to discuss the sale of real property, including any form of a water right or water shares
f discussion regarding deployment of security personnel, devices, or systems
g the purpose of considering information that is designated as a trade secret, as defined in Section 13-24-2, if the public body's consideration of the information is necessary in order to properly conduct a procurement under Title 63G, Chapter 6a, Utah Procurement Code
